    Understanding Osteoarthritis and the Need for Effective Solutions

    Osteoarthritis (OA) is a degenerative joint disease characterized by the breakdown of cartilage, leading to pain, stiffness, and reduced mobility. It affects millions worldwide, with common areas including the knees, hips, hands, and spine. Traditional treatments often focus on symptom management, such as pain relievers, anti-inflammatory drugs, and physical therapy. While these can provide relief, they don't always address the underlying cellular mechanisms of tissue degradation. The search for therapies that can not only alleviate pain but also promote healing and slow disease progression is paramount.

    The Science Behind Red Light Therapy for Joint Health

    Red light therapy utilizes specific wavelengths of light, primarily in the red (600-700 nm) and near-infrared (700-1000 nm) spectrums. These wavelengths penetrate tissues and are absorbed by chromophores within the cells, particularly cytochrome c oxidase (CCO) in the mitochondria. This absorption triggers a cascade of intracellular events:

    • Increased ATP Production: By stimulating CCO, RLT enhances cellular respiration and boosts the production of adenosine triphosphate (ATP), the primary energy currency of the cell (Chung et al., 2012, Annals of Biomedical Engineering).
    • Reduced Inflammation: RLT has been shown to modulate the inflammatory response, decreasing pro-inflammatory cytokines and increasing anti-inflammatory mediators (Lim et al., 2015, Lasers in Medical Science).
    • Enhanced Collagen Synthesis: Therapeutic light can stimulate fibroblasts, leading to increased collagen and elastin production, essential for cartilage and connective tissue repair (Gladkov et al., 2021, Lasers in Medical Science).
    • Improved Blood Flow: Vasodilation promoted by RLT can improve circulation to affected areas, delivering more oxygen and nutrients while facilitating waste removal (Rochkind et al., 2007, Lasers in Surgery and Medicine).

    These cellular and molecular effects collectively contribute to pain reduction, improved tissue healing, and enhanced functional capacity in affected joints.

    Case Study Review: Red Light Therapy for Knee Osteoarthritis

    Knee osteoarthritis is one of the most studied conditions in the realm of red light therapy. Numerous randomized controlled trials and meta-analyses have investigated its impact. Here’s a summary of key findings:

    Meta-analysis 1: Bjordal et al. (2015)

    A comprehensive meta-analysis by Bjordal, Lopes-Martins, and Iversen published in BMC Musculoskeletal Disorders in 2015 synthesized data from 18 randomized controlled trials involving patients with knee osteoarthritis. This review found that high-intensity laser therapy, a form of RLT, significantly reduced pain and improved functional ability immediately following treatment and at short to medium-term follow-up.

    Key finding: Patients receiving RLT experienced a significant reduction in pain intensity (mean difference of -2.04 on an 11-point scale from 0 to 10), and improved WOMAC (Western Ontario and McMaster Universities Arthritis Index) scores for pain, stiffness, and physical function compared to placebo or sham treatments. The authors concluded that RLT, when applied with appropriate doses and wavelengths, is effective for knee OA.

    Meta-analysis 2: Huang et al. (2015)

    Another meta-analysis published by Huang et al. in the Orthopaedic Journal of China in 2015 specifically examined the effectiveness of low-level laser therapy (LLLT) for knee osteoarthritis. This study included 10 randomized controlled trials with a total of 820 patients.

    Key finding: The pooled results demonstrated that LLLT significantly reduced pain (standardized mean difference [SMD] = -0.73) and improved stiffness (SMD = -0.62) and physical function (SMD = -0.66) compared to placebo. The authors noted that optimized treatment parameters (dose, wavelength, frequency) were crucial for achieving these positive outcomes.

    Single-Center Study: Hegedus et al. (2009)

    A randomized, placebo-controlled study by Hegedus et al. published in Photomedicine and Laser Surgery in 2009 investigated the immediate effects of LLLT in 100 patients with knee OA. Patients received single treatments with either active LLLT or a sham device.

    Key finding: The group receiving active LLLT showed a statistically significant reduction in pain intensity immediately after treatment, with an average pain reduction of 50% compared to baseline. The placebo group showed minimal change. This study highlights the rapid analgesic effects often observed with RLT.

    These studies collectively provide strong evidence that red light therapy is not just a palliative measure but a therapeutic intervention that can significantly improve pain and function in individuals suffering from knee osteoarthritis. The consistent positive findings from rigorous meta-analyses underscore its clinical utility.

    Beyond the Knees: Red Light Therapy for Other Joints

    While knee OA is a primary focus, red light therapy's benefits extend to other joints affected by pain and inflammation:

    • Hand Osteoarthritis: A study by Alayat et al. in Lasers in Medical Science (2014) showed that LLLT significantly reduced pain, improved grip strength, and enhanced functional ability in patients with hand osteoarthritis.
    • Shoulder Pain: Both acute and chronic shoulder pain, including adhesive capsulitis and rotator cuff injuries, have shown positive responses to RLT. A review by Cotler et al. in Lasers in Surgery and Medicine (2015) highlighted RLT's ability to reduce pain and improve range of motion in various shoulder conditions.
    • Temporomandibular Joint (TMJ) Disorders: Clinical trials, such as one by Emshoff et al. in Pain (2007), have demonstrated that LLLT can effectively reduce pain and improve jaw function in patients with chronic TMJ pain.

    Frequently Asked Questions

    Q: How quickly can I expect to see results from red light therapy for joint pain?

    A: The timeframe for results can vary depending on the individual, the severity of the condition, and the specific treatment protocol. Many studies, such as Hegedus et al. (2009, Photomedicine and Laser Surgery), report immediate pain reduction after a single session. However, more significant and sustained improvements in pain, stiffness, and function often require a series of consistent treatments, typically over several weeks.     Q: Is red light therapy safe for everyone, and are there any side effects?

    A: Red light therapy is generally considered very safe, with minimal reported side effects when used correctly. Side effects, if any, are usually mild and temporary, such as temporary redness or warmth in the treated area. It's non-invasive and does not use harmful UV rays. However, individuals who are pregnant, have certain medical conditions, or are taking photosensitizing medications should consult with their healthcare provider before beginning RLT.     Q: How does red light therapy compare to other treatments for osteoarthritis?

    A: Red light therapy offers a distinct advantage as a non-pharmacological, non-invasive treatment that not only alleviates pain but also promotes cellular repair. Unlike pain medications that primarily mask symptoms, RLT targets underlying cellular dysfunction (Chung et al., 2012, Annals of Biomedical Engineering). While RLT can be used as a standalone therapy, it also complements other treatments like physical therapy and exercise. Many individuals find it to be an excellent alternative or adjunct to traditional approaches, reducing reliance on drugs or postponing more invasive interventions.

    Q: What is the ideal frequency and duration of red light therapy sessions for joint pain?

    A: Optimal frequency and duration depend on the specific condition, its severity, and the RLT device used. Research typically employs sessions ranging from 10 to 20 minutes, 2-5 times per week for several weeks. For instance, meta-analyses by Bjordal et al. (2015, BMC Musculoskeletal Disorders) and Huang et al. (2015, Orthopaedic Journal of China) highlight consistent positive outcomes with such protocols.
